Transaction 59db798d81684d83068639ec640e2dab3d733e999335be340ce029693f014c26
1 Input
1 Output
-
59db798d81684d83068639ec640e2dab3d733e999335be340ce029693f014c26:0
- value
- 2134855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c94ec4fe37eac8338878b6c91b08a75feede6b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16XKwsLGo4S6SUz6a9LdoXcy9WJhGovATB